Our client, who are based in Fife, and are a global leader in flow control solutions, is seeking an experienced Maintenance Electrician to carry out reactive and planned electrical maintenance activities as part of an established site-based maintenance team.
Key Responsibilities:
- Assist with the implementation of a comprehensive Computerised Maintenance Management System (CMMS).
- Ability to read and understand electrical drawings, circuit diagrams / schematics and O&M manuals.
- A strong electrical fault-finding capability in reactive maintenance.
- A great attention to detail carrying out planned maintenance activities.
- A strong team working ethic with a flexible working approach.
- Experience working with 415V Motors and auxiliary control equipment/systems.
- Experience working with PLCs, star/delta startups & variable speed drives (VSD).
- Assist with the development of apprentice worker(s).
- Help mechanical fitters or other ad-hoc duties as and when required.
- Strong problem-solving skills.
Requirements:
- Time served electrician, qualified to BS 7671 IEE Regulations 18th Edition.
- Demonstrating previous experience in a similar role is essential.
- A full UK driving License is essential.
- Training and competency with regards to the safe isolation of electrical and mechanical equipment essential.
- Training and qualifications related to LOLER, PUWER and DSEAR regulations an advantage.
- 11kv High Voltage competency desirable but not essential.
- Good communicator with the ability to effectively present information in written and verbal format.
- Ability to work at height and in confined spaces - Physically demanding role.
